Output 3b15816eeddf784db58b8740863f35e0885f3d04628c0c1116ace5ddb1139e53:1

value
8903213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2467365f49919fdfca06e3de4a157f052ce7911e OP_EQUAL
address
351VtmkNWGb57axZPCzY6vRHc5iY24UHL2
transaction
3b15816eeddf784db58b8740863f35e0885f3d04628c0c1116ace5ddb1139e53
confirmations
364008
spent
true